Why Is Measuring Social Media Results Important?
Brands benefit from social media performance measurement:
- Recognize the content that appeals to their audience.
- Spend money more wisely.
- To increase ROI, fine-tune your targeting.
- Monitor business results and conversions.
- Maintain your edge in a crowded online marketplace.
Even the most inventive campaigns could perform poorly without adequate tracking, wasting time and money.
What Are Organic Social Media Results?
Your social media content’s unpaid performance is referred to as “organic results.” This comprises: Follower likes, comments, and shares.
- Unpaid impressions and reach.
- Followers acquired by posting without promotion.

What Are Inorganic Social Media Results?
Spending on advertising is what drives inorganic, or paid, social media results. This covers sponsored content as well as promoted advertisements.
- enhanced content to make it more visible.
- campaigns for generating leads.
- campaigns for retargeting.
Paid campaigns target particular user groups and increase the reach of your content. Both organic and inorganic techniques are used in a well-balanced strategy to produce a potent performance engine.
How to Track Social Media Results
Tracking is the first step toward improving performance. Here’s how to do it effectively:
- Leverage Analytics Tools on Social Media Platforms
Every platform offers a unique set of potent analytics tools for tracking performance:
- Meta (Instagram & Facebook): You can monitor ad performance, likes, comments, reach, and engagement with the help of the insights dashboard.
- YouTube: Track views, watch time, audience retention, and subscriber growth with YouTube Studio.
- LinkedIn: Analytics provide information about clicks, engagement, follower demographics, and post impressions.
- X (formerly Twitter): Twitter Analytics provides information about link clicks, mentions, and tweet engagement.

- Utilize Google Analytics
It lets you know which social media sites are bringing in the most traffic.
- how users act on your website.
- Goal completions and conversion paths.
You can pinpoint the precise social media campaign that resulted in a sale or form submission by configuring UTM parameters.
- Use Social Media Reporting Tools
All of your performance metrics are consolidated into a single dashboard by sophisticated reporting tools like Hootsuite, Sprout Social, Buffer, and Zoho Social. These instruments provide:
- Analysis across platforms
- Reporting that is automated
- Real-time insights from data

How to Measure Social Media Results
Now that you’re tracking data, here are the core metrics to evaluate your success:
- Conversion Rate
This is the percentage of users who complete a desired action after interacting with your social content.
- Reach and Impressions
The quantity of distinct users who view your content is known as reach. Impressions are the total number of times your content appears, whether or not someone clicks on it.
- Engagement
The mentions, likes, comments, shares, retweets, and saves! The target audience that is involved and engages with the brand, reacting to the brand’s content on an emotional level is often a good sign in terms of boosting your brand presence.
- Brand Awareness
Although they are hard to measure exactly, increased followers, mentions, and search volume are signs of brand awareness. Insightful data can also be obtained from surveys and brand lift studies.
How to Improve Social Media Results
Want to level up your performance? Here are expert-backed tips:
- Posting when your audience is most interested will help you get the most out of your posting schedule.
- Create Excellent Visual Content: Videos, infographics, and carousels typically perform better.
- Actively Participate: React to comments and messages. Create Q&As, polls, and interactive stories.
- Use A/B testing to identify the most effective headlines, creatives, and calls to action.
- Investments in Strategic Paid Advertising: Launch focused campaigns with clear objectives in mind rather than merely promoting posts.
- Monitor Trends and Rivals: Stay current by looking at what your competitors are doing well.
- Update Content Frequently: Make sure your content is varied and new rather than reposting the same things over and over again.
